Viktoria Kahui is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Ecology and Economics and Econometrics.
According to data from OpenAlex, Viktoria Kahui has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 313 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 12 papers in Ecology and 8 papers in Economics and Econometrics. Recurrent topics in Viktoria Kahui’s work include Marine and fisheries research (12 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(9 papers) and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(9 papers). Viktoria Kahui is often cited by papers focused on Marine and fisheries research (12 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(9 papers) and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(9 papers). Viktoria Kahui coll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, Norway and United States. Viktoria Kahui's co-authors include Claire W. Armstrong, Naomi S. Foley, Ilan Noy, Margrethe Aanesen and Godwin Kofi Vondolia and has published in prestigious journals such as Ecological Economics, Land Economics and Restoration Ecology.
